WebMay 18, 2016 · The center of the circle is at the intersection of the perpendicular bisectors of the two chords. Any of the segments joining this point to an endpoint of a chord will be a radius. WebJul 7, 2024 · In addition to being a measure of distance, a radius is also a segment that goes from a circle’s center to a point on the circle. Chord: A segment that connects two points on a circle is called a chord. Diameter: A chord that passes through a circle’s center is a diameter of the circle. WebAnswer: The radius of a circle with a chord is r=√(l 2 +4h 2) / 2, where 'l' is the length of the chord and 'h' is the perpendicular distance from the center of the circle to the chord.
